The widespread “diseases of civilization,” such as changes in the lifestyle of a modern person, the presence of a large number of stress factors, and external pollution, prompts scientists to search for effective means of their prevention. One such remedy, recognized by WHO, is to increase the level of physical activity – a simple and affordable method to reduce the risk for many pathological conditions, including metabolic syndrome, type 2 diabetes mellitus, and diseases of the cardiovascular system.

What studies show
A group of scientists from China and the United States led by Dr. Dongshi Wang added the evidence base on the beneficial effects of exercise with the results of a new meta-analytical study. In it, the authors obtained evidence that physical activity helps to get rid of various kinds of addiction: alcohol, drug and nicotine.
Scientists came to this conclusion after searching for all relevant studies on this problem, and analyzing the results of the most indicative of them. In total, the analysis included 22 works out of 3683 reviewed and reviews from online aa meetings. With their help, scientists were able to assess the effect of exercise on withdrawal symptoms, withdrawal symptoms, anxiety and depression levels.

Among the possible mechanisms of action of such physical activity, scientists note their long-term effect on the structure and functioning of the brain. Thus, physical activity regulates the transcription of brain neurotrophic factor (BDNF) and synaptic plasticity, which is an important point in the rehabilitation of persons with addictions, since it helps to restore neuronal damage caused by the action of a psychoactive substance and contributes to the development of new patterns of behavior.
Exercises reduce the likelihood of hospitalization for COVID-19
Physical education has a beneficial effect on health, including increasing immunity, doctors have said for many years. This is also true for COVID-19, a team of Brazilian scientists from the University of São Paulo has shown. The work was supervised by Marcelo Rodrigues dos Santos. Physically active patients diagnosed with COVID-19 are admitted to the hospital less often than those with a lower level of mobility, experts found.
Scientists asked those who recovered from coronavirus infection to answer several questions. In the online questionnaire, it was necessary to indicate general information about yourself (age, gender, existing diseases, level of education, physical activity) and indicate how difficult the disease was. The data of 938 people were used for the analysis, the answers of about 700 respondents were eliminated for various reasons. So, the study was not influenced by the questionnaires of people who could not confirm that they really had COVID-19.
Then the participants were divided into two groups. The first included those who lead an active lifestyle, the second – a sedentary one. People in the first group had at least two and a half hours of moderate physical activity per week, or at least 75 minutes of high-intensity exercise. In terms of a day, it turned out about 21 or 11 minutes, respectively. People from the second category moved less than this time.
Then the researchers compared how hard the representatives of both categories tolerated the disease. It turned out that people who were mobile before being infected were hospitalized a third less often than less active patients. However, the indicators of those who were admitted to the hospital no longer differed: the infection was equally hard for those who led an active lifestyle, and those who were sedentary. Symptoms, time of hospitalization, frequency of intubation and oxygen therapy rates were approximately the same.
Increasing activity may be a strategy to prevent the clinical severity of coronavirus in older adults, the study authors argue.
